A capacitor is a bit similar to your car battery; it stores electrical energy. A car audio capacitor will help you get the most from your amplifier.

Without a capacitor your amplifier will be robbed of power by parts like your lights, engine, and air conditioner. So what happens when your car audio amplifier doesn’t receive enough power?

The light will dim each time a heavy bass note sounds. If a capacitor had been present there would have been enough energy to power your amp. Equipped with capacitor and an adequate power supply, your system will get every bit of current it needs. No longer will your car amplifier be hungry for power.

Like Captain Kirk on the Starship Enterprise, you “need more power!” Unlike a battery, where power is stored up and released in a slow, steady stream of juice, capacitors store up electrical energy and release it in powerful jolts. Mounted right next to your amplifiers, capacitors (also known as “stiffening capacitors” because they stiffen the strength of a sagging bass response) provide the extra electrical boost required to drive the subwoofers speakers when the power they need is being sucked off by other systems (like the headlights or the neon undercarriage trim).

Resistance is kind of like an energy floodgate; it determines how fast or slow power can enter or leave an electrical storage system. Capacitors have a very low resistance. Why don’t we use capacitors to power everything?

The catch is when a sudden push is needed to drive your subwoofers speakers harder than the trickle of power a battery can provide. A stiffening capacitor detects this drop in power and releases a compensating jolt to fill the gap, keeping power levels uniformly high and preventing that sagging bass and clipping of tone that wipes out the perfect music experience.
